OMC picks Delplain for Human Resources Manager

Olympic Medical Center recently promoted 15-year employee Heather Delplain to Human Resources Manager.

Reporting directly to the chief human resources officer, Delplain will oversee employee and labor relations, benefits, leaves of absence, and general HR functions, as well as manage a number of HR personnel.

“Heather is a natural leader and I am very pleased to have her manage many of the key operational functions of the HR department at OMC,” said Jennifer Burkhardt, chief human resources officer and general counsel for Olympic Medical Center. “Heather’s HR expertise combined with her caring manner is such an asset to OMC.”

Delplain initially joined Olympic Medical Center in 2003 coordinating employee benefits and leaves. In becoming a Senior HR Business partner several years ago, she began working closely with Burkhardt in employee relations. She is also a leader in employee engagement work.

Delplain proved herself as a critical staff person in major implementations including business enterprise software Lawson in 2012 and most recently an HR talent management software called Cornerstone.

Delplain has also been a trainer for Lean Process Improvement at OMC, as well as a long-time presenter for Olympic Medical’s Service Excellence training.

She was added to the New Employee Orientation slate of presenters in 2017.

“Heather can be counted on to step up and take on new challenges, and do so positively,” Burkhardt said. “With nearly 1,500 employees at Olympic Medical and an ever-growing need for HR, she is the right person in this role to support HR’s mission in ensuring we are providing quality HR services.”
